Six workers suffered burn injuries in a gas explosion while working at a dyeing factory in the BSCIC industrial area of Narayanganj on Sunday.
The explosion occurred around 8:30 am in the boiler room on the ground floor of the factory, reports UNB.
The injured workers --Al Amin, 30, Azizulla, 32, Selim, 35, Jalal Molla, 40, Nazmul Huda, 35, and security guard supervisor Nur Mohammad, 35, -- are now undergoing treatment at the National Burn and Plastic Surgery Institute.
Al Amin, one of the injured, told UNB, “We were working in the boiler room of SM Dyeing Printing and Finishing when a loud explosion occurred from the gas line around 8:30 am. The room caught fire instantly and all six of us were burnt. We were later rescued and brought to the National Burn and Plastic Surgery Institute.”
Dr Shawn Bin Rahman, resident surgeon of the hospital, said the patients are receiving treatment in the emergency department. “We cannot yet specify the extent of burns as their dressings are going on,” he added.
